LIVESTRONG Care Plan

OncoLink has teamed up with the Lance Armstrong Foundation to create an individualized plan of care based on the Institute of Medicine recommendations for cancer survivors. This free and easy to use program provides cancer survivors with information regarding the health risks they face as a result of cancer therapies. It encourages them to review the plan with their healthcare team to further assess their risk and become active participants in their follow up care.
